i've read in a couple of threads that ceramic tile can be put directly on sheetrock (without a backer -or cement- board) using a product called OMNI-something or other.

here's my problem. we just finished redoing our kitchen and my wife wants to put ceramic tile on the walls between the backsplash and the bottom of the upper wall cabinets. well, before the cabinets and counter top were installed, i hung new sheetrock, and in a fit of neatness, primed, and then painted it using latex enamel semi-gloss.

so, here's my question. will the mastic mentioned above (or it's equivelent) stick to the newly painted wall?


55Redneck
09-01-02, 01:20 AM
No problem there Ron. Just scuff it up with some 50-80 grit sand paper and you'll be good to go. ;) The glue will get a better bite if the surface is "Roughed up".
